New VIP 'experience' at DLH

Sorry if this has been posted already but I forgot about it. It's basically a new VIP dinner and Illuminations viewing experience at DLH. They used to do it a few years ago when Dreams began. I took a photo of the leaflet. Believe it has to be booked via the Concierge at DLH.

You get cocktails (which could be non-alcoholic if you like) and nibbles, for about an hour in the bar. Then you go into fhe restaurant for a four course meal - anything you choose from their menu. Wines accompany each course (but again you could have soft drinks) finishing with coffee. Then you are taken up in the 'secret lift' to the Founder's Bar, which only Castle Club guests can use otherwise. You are served champagne and petits fours (which we asked to be wrapped in foil to take away). You then have a wonderful view of the castle show.

An incredibly romantic evening (although we also saw a dad and daughter do it - the waiter called her 'princess' throughout, it was so sweet.
